FAQ: Criminalize Predatory Lending (Metre Interest)

शिकारी ऋण (मेट्रे ब्याज) अपराधीकरण

8 frequently asked questions about this government commitment

What is the current status of Criminalize Predatory Lending (Metre Interest)?

The current status of "Criminalize Predatory Lending (Metre Interest)" is In Progress with 45% progress. Loan sharks charging insane interest rates become criminals. Your family can't be trapped in debt slavery. Last updated: 2026-03-21.

Who is responsible for Criminalize Predatory Lending (Metre Interest)?

Key ministries involved: Ministry of Law & Justice, Ministry of Finance. Key officials: Law Minister, Finance Minister.

How much budget is allocated for Criminalize Predatory Lending (Metre Interest)?

Budget details: Minimal — legislative reform

Which provinces are affected by Criminalize Predatory Lending (Metre Interest)?

"Criminalize Predatory Lending (Metre Interest)" is a national-scope commitment affecting all seven provinces of Nepal.

What progress has been made on Criminalize Predatory Lending (Metre Interest)?

"Criminalize Predatory Lending (Metre Interest)" is currently at 45% progress (In Progress). Key progress indicators being tracked: Anti-usury bill passed, predatory lenders prosecuted, victims compensated. There are 3 evidence items and 0 sources contributing to this assessment.
